Eligibility Criteria for Working Remotely in Canada

Before packing your virtual bags, consider the following factors:

  1. Immigration Status:
    • If you’re not a Canadian citizen or permanent resident, obtaining a work permit is crucial. Visit the official Canada.ca website to apply online.
    • Answer a few questions to determine the appropriate process.
    • Pay the necessary fees (work permit fee: $155, open work permit holder fee: $100).
  2. Skills and Experience:
    • Highlight your expertise, qualifications, and relevant work history.
    • Some remote jobs may require specific certifications or degrees.

Top Job Boards for Remote Positions

!Job Boards

  1. GC Jobs (Government of Canada):
    • Explore the GC Jobs website.
    • Create an account or sign in.
    • Use relevant keywords (e.g., “remote,” “telecommute,” “work from home”) to search for job listings.
    • Apply to positions aligned with your skills and interests.
  2. Private Job Boards and Websites:
    • Check out popular platforms like Indeed, LinkedIn, and Glassdoor.
    • Utilize search filters to narrow down results to remote or telecommuting jobs.
    • Research companies known for offering remote work options.
